Yonge Street Mission (YSM) is a vibrant, non-profit Christian organization leading a collective movement to end chronic poverty in Toronto.
Since 1896, we've worked to transform the lives of people living with poverty, going beyond immediate needs by offering wrap-around support via holistic programs and services, and a pathway which enables street-involved youth, families in need, adults experiencing poverty and vulnerable communities to move from surviving to thriving.

Employer Engagement Supervisor who is passionate, called to oversee and can provide direction to the Employer Engagement strategy, ensuring that high quality job opportunities are created for YSM program participants.
The Employer Engagement Supervisor will provide leadership to the Employer Engagement team, as well as coordinate the effective delivery of all aspects of planning, development, delivery, and evaluation of employer engagement services.
This position reports to the Workforce Development Director.Responsibilities:
- Ensure that high quality job opportunities with career potential are created for YSM participants
- Network and steward long term relationships with employers, unions and professional associations, to facilitate workforce development needs
- Develop and oversee operational procedures that effectively connect program participants with jobs
- Research and document labour market trends to facilitate the identification of good employers and decent work for participants
- Coordinate efforts of the Workforce Development team and employers in designing training approaches that stimulate engagement on the part of participants, while also meeting labour market needs
- Deliver Job Matching/Placement/Incentive (JMPI) services for the grant funded programs
- Ensure accurate and timely employer related program records, as well as maintain statistics and reports. This includes regular reporting on KPIs, data analysis for programs, and outcome evaluation
- Provide leadership to the Employer Engagement team, including: spiritual care, coaching, staff development and performance management
